@femmedeitiesnet | event one | african diaspora ↳ caribbean folklore » mama d’leau » “mama d’leau...is the protector and healer of all river animals, according to the folklore of trinidad and tobago. she is usually depicted as a beautiful woman with long hair, who sits on upper body and arms and from her waist downwards twists into coils. Her tongue becomes forked and she holds a golden comb which she passes through her snaky hair.” (x)
